About The Position

This position reports to the Operations Manager, or their designee, and provides customer service over the phone, via email, and in person. Provides administrative support for the Facilities Service Center staff. Tasks include: providing customer service, answering phones, radio dispatch, assisting with walk-in customers, as well as performing various administrative and basic accounting functions. This includes assisting with data entry tasks with our work order data system.
